Giter Club home page Giter Club logo

m9awpf's Introduction

注意:M9A v1.x的适配工作还在测试中,见最新的release

M9AWPF

拿WPF框架写的一个M9A的UI

现在的状态只是能用,很多东西还不是最优化
欢迎各位大佬贡献代码

release里面有做好的整合包
记得设置下ADB位置和端口就可以了

Build

git下来后用vs打开应该就好了
然后这个项目没有带M9A的文件,需要自己下载

使用的Nuget包

modern WPF
.net community toolkit

m9awpf's People

Contributors

1m188 avatar karongh avatar mlacookie av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

Watchers

 avatar

m9awpf's Issues

跟随M9A v1.0.0可能的修改方向

RT,M9A新的v1.0.0-beta3应该是把命令行界面暴露出来成interface.json了,测试了一下应该是可以直接根据读取的interface.json模拟terminal的输出结果,所以我的设想路线是:

  1. 读取interface.json
  2. 如果存在config文件(config/maa_pi_config.json)则读取里面的adb_path,address和resource(官服/B服),以及上次任务列表task
  3. 备份config文件后临时移除config文件
  4. 根据GUI的配置调用MaaPiCli.exe并模拟输入指令,然后执行

这样可以避免去构建Json,可以更好的自适应M9A可能的变动

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.